#994779 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#994779 is composed of 60% red, 27.8%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.6% magenta, 20.9%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 323.4 degrees, a saturation of 36.6% and a lightness of 43.9%. #994779 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8ef2 with #330000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#994779 color description : Dark moderate pink.

#994779 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#994779 has RGB values of R:153, G:71,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.54, Y:0.21,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 10045305.

Shades and Tints of #994779

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060304 is the darkest color, while #fbf7f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#994779

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#776971 is the less saturated color, while #de0288 is the most saturated one.
